



The Vacant, Fallow and Virgin Land Management Central Committee held the meeting 8/2022 on Friday in Nay Pyi Taw.
In this meeting, Union Minister U Hla Moe highlighted the guidance of the State Administration Council which is to develop agricultural and livestock sector and to promote MSME products and develop the local economy with local raw materials of agricultural and livestock products.
In the implementation of the guidance, the land that can be used for agriculture and livestock sector is being managed to be fully utilized, the Union Minister added. And, the vacant, fallow and virgin land-related matters were presented and attendees made discussions on the matters.
It’s learnt that from the time of the previous government to the current period, about 1.6 million vacant, fallow and virgin lands were reclaimed as the users did not follow the laws and by-laws.
